Local newspaper classifieds? An MT friend of mine happened upon an ad in the local newspaper for someone looking for a local person (not a business) to type up manuscripts part time. I know it's not much, but it's something.

Craigslist? Occasionally, I actually will see an ad for a medical transcriptionist on Craigslist for a local doctor's office. You can do a search as well - try searching for "transcription." Someone else I know also found a typing job on Craigslist under the writing heading, not transcription, but typing up procedure manuals, etc.

Local docs? Although they rarely advertise in my area, there are a few local orthopedic groups and cardiology groups that still use in-house transcriptionists. Maybe cold call? That is, if you still want to stay in the transcription field.

Keep applying, applying, applying at your local hospital as well. Don't give up. I keep applying for unit secretary positions at my local hospitals and have been doing so for the past 8 months or so (other positions as well), but so far also with no success.

You've probably tried all of these suggestions already and I'm sorry if I'm repeating the obvious, but I just wanted to share them with you after reading your post.
